Transaction 8ea0636f74e49a9494129843fc62c04d1872ea3ba421602d27f4c6534875cc1d

3 Input
2 Outputs
  • 8ea0636f74e49a9494129843fc62c04d1872ea3ba421602d27f4c6534875cc1d:0
  • value  994222
    address  3QGWzDiFG7aByaLNg4SJ32in1LHeo3EeMW
  • 8ea0636f74e49a9494129843fc62c04d1872ea3ba421602d27f4c6534875cc1d:1
  • value  1876782
    address  3DDMCGx7afb4nSPFPviHwQv3KLineTGkU2